Overview
The innovative and industry-focused MSc Drug Discovery and Development course at University of Sunderland gives you the advanced knowledge and practical skills needed for a successful career in the pharmaceutical sector, or as a stepping stone to PhD research.
You’ll study a broad range of topics including pharmaceutics, pharmaceutical analysis, drug design, pharmacology, disease biology, proteomics, pharmacogenomics, and medicines regulation aligned with international ICH guidelines. The course allows you to specialise in areas that match your interests, such as formulation, quality control, or drug discovery.
Teaching is delivered by experienced academics with global expertise, supported by modern laboratories equipped with state-of-the-art technology. A key feature of the course is a research project, designed around your interests and often involving real world challenges or collaboration with industry partners.
Careers
Graduates go on to a wide range of roles across drug design, clinical and pre-clinical research, product development, regulatory affairs, and pharmaceutical analysis. Previous students have secured roles with leading companies including GSK, Merck Sharp & Dohme, Eisai, Reckitt Benckiser, Covance, and Norbrook Laboratories. Many international graduates have progressed into regulatory, quality assurance, and pharmacovigilance positions, while others have moved into PhD study. This MSc is designed to help you contribute immediately and effectively in today’s fast-moving pharmaceutical environment.

Courses include:
- Essential Pharmaceutical Science Research and Study Skills
- Pharmaceutical R&D: Sciences and Regulation
- Science and Technology for Drug Discovery
- Science and Technology for Drug Development
- Double Project

General requirements
- We require a 2:2 honours degree or above in one of the following subject areas: pharmacology, pharmaceutical chemistry, pharmacy, biomedical sciences, or a related subject. Alternative qualifications may be considered if supported by relevant experience.
